Backbone.js - první kroky

Obsah
Přesčas Javascript získala v oblasti webového vývoje bezkonkurenční důležitost, je to částečně způsobeno skutečností, že s novými standardy, jako je HTML5 S jeho pomocí, implementací AJAX a rámců jako bylo možné využívat mnoho nových funkcí jQuery Y Mootools také měli vliv.
Po tom všem, co se stalo, se objevila nová evoluce a to zahrnuje Backbone.js, je vznik Rámce MVC v Javascriptu.
Proč v Javascriptu potřebujete rámec MVC?
Toto je možná první otázka, která nás napadá, protože až dosud vše, co jsme znali s MVC, fungovalo v jazyce serveru, nyní máme možnost pracovat s tím přímo od klienta.
V případě webových stránek, které jsou jednostránkové nebo také nazývané SPA jednostránkovými aplikacemiJsou velmi běžné, protože nám umožňují mít celý tok aplikace nebo webu na jedné stránce, což výrazně snižuje požadavky HTTP, a proto po načtení na klienta skončíme s lehčím webem.
Backbone.js
Backbone.js je lehká knihovna Javascript, která nám umožňuje přidat strukturu do kódu na straně klienta, umožňuje nám oddělit různé kontexty kompletní aplikace a ponechat nám tak čistší a organizovanější kód, který v budoucnu umožní jeho snadnou údržbu.
VyzkoušetChcete -li získat Backbone.js můžeme jít na jejich webové stránky na adrese http: / /backbonejs.org/ a tam si můžeme stáhnout produkční verzi, která je stabilní verze a komprimované, nebo pokud jsme ve vývojovém prostředí, můžeme použít vývojářská verze to není komprimováno, což je následně komentováno a dokumentováno ve zdrojovém kódu, nebo můžeme také stáhnout soubor hlavní verze což je nejnovější nestabilní verze.
Podívejme se na další obrazovce, o jaké webové stránky jde Backbone.js odkud je stáhneme:

ZVĚTŠIT

Kdy ji musíme použít?
Tato otázka může být druhou, která nás napadne, když se setkáme s touto technologií, jak jsme zmínili na začátku, tato knihovna je velmi užitečná při vytváření jednostránkových aplikací, není to však jediný případ, můžeme ji také použít, když zatížení je těžké. aplikace padá na pohledy a na to, jak jsou generovány, nebo když jednoduše chceme, aby naše aplikace znovu načetla na obrazovku co nejméně prvků.
PříkladA praktický příklad o tom, jak můžeme použít knihovnu jako Backbone.js může to být, pokud chceme vybudovat správce dokumentů, jako je Gmail.
Gmail načte vše, co se týká zpracování, při prvním spuštění webu, poté obnovíme pouze potřebné sekce, aniž bychom museli stránku znovu načíst úplně, proto můžeme číst e -mail a když klikneme na tlačítko pro psaní, generuje se prostor, kde můžete vytvořit nový e -mail, aniž byste museli znovu načítat a přijít o to, co jste dělali na pozadí.
S tímto dokončujeme tento návod, již známe nejzákladnější aspekty Backbone.js o jeho filozofii a o tom, jak jej můžeme aplikovat, a o tom, jakých aplikací můžeme dosáhnout.Líbil se vám tento návod a pomohl mu?Autora můžete odměnit stisknutím tohoto tlačítka, čímž mu dáte kladný bod

Vám pomůže rozvoji místa, sdílet stránku s přáteli

wave wave wave wave wave